Job Summary:

The LVN administers skilled nursing care under the supervision of a Registered Nurse, for clients in their place of residence, coordinate care with the interdisciplinary team, patient/family and referring agency.

Responsibilities:

  • Completes and updates, as needed, a competency skills assessment that accurately identifies their nursing skills. Accepts only nursing assignments that they can perform safely, are within their individual scope of practice and commensurate with their education/experience. Notifies agency leadership immediately if an assigned task must be restaffed due to their lack of education or experience in performing the assigned task.  Actively participates in educational opportunities that widen their scope of practice and increases their nursing competency skill set.
  • Under the direct supervision of the home health Field RN, provides nursing services as ordered on the home health Plan of Care (POC). Responsible for maintaining a clear understanding of the POC and implementing nursing services as ordered by the physician.
  • Identifies changes in patient condition, such as a deterioration in status, and communicates these changes quickly and effectively to the Field RN, clinical manager, the interdisciplinary team and the physician. Initiates the appropriate nursing response to changes in the patient’s condition and ensures that clear documentation exists within the clinical record regarding the change and nursing response.
  • Actively participates in the case conference process by providing a report to the clinical manager on the conferenced patients they have seen in the previous 60-day period.  Full time LVN staff are required to attend the case conference meetings.
  • Submits thorough and accurate documentation of the nursing services that were ordered on the POC and performed by the LVN, per agency policy.
  • Promptly updates the EMR medication profile when changes to the patient’s medication regimen are identified.  Reviews the patient’s medication profile with each skilled nursing visit and ensures that the patient/caregiver has a correct medication list in the home, written in plain language.
  • Ensures appropriate home folder communication exists by logging vital sign values and other pertinent clinical information in the patient’s home folder with each visit.

Job Summary:

The RN administers skilled nursing care for clients in their place of residence, coordinates care with the interdisciplinary team, patient/family and referring agency and assumes the responsibility for coordination of care.

Responsibilities:

  • Assess home patients to identify the physical, psycho-social and environmental needs as evidenced by documentation, clinical record, case conference and evaluations.
  • Implement/develop/document the plan of care to ensure quality and continuity of care.
  • Provide care utilizing infection control measures that protect both the patient and the staff.
  • Supervise and provide clinical directions to the home health aide and the LVN to ensure quality and continuity of services provided.
  • Provide effective communication to patient/family, team members and other health care professionals.
